Jacques Rohault Quote

Daily Experience, and a Thousand Observations made by the Industry of Men in past Ages, and which we our selves have confirmed, do sufficiently convince us, that there is no part of the Earth, be it never so great or small, but that in Time it undergoes some Alteration.


Rouhault's System of Natural Philosophy (Volume 2), Part III, Chapter I
